A Murine Model of Ischemic Cardiomyopathy Induced by Repetitive Ischemia and Reperfusion

Repetitive brief murine myocardial I/R induces reversible fibrotic remodeling and ventricular dysfunction, without myocardial infarction and necrosis, and may play a role in the pathogenesis of ischemic cardiomyopathy and myocardial hibernation.
